I want to figure out how to install stable, already packaged versions
of only some KDE applications on a Fedora Core 3 system which already
has X and Qt. In other words, I would like to start from some KDE
source RPMs for Fedora and massage the spec and Make files until I get
other RPMs that *only* install:

KOffice
Konqueror
KMail
Kopete
Kpdf
(maybe a couple more whose name escapes me now)
all the base KDE libraries that are *really* needed by those programs

*nothing* else: NO sound, only one theme and set of icons, no
wallpaper, no animation.... 

The purpose is to build a mini-KDe desktop for basic SOHO applications
which has modern functionality (gpg, Khtml, Imap OpenDocument
support...) but is as light as possible on RAM and hard drive.

Said this:

what are the latest stable SRPMS for the apps above for FC3, and
where?

any suggestion and tip on how and which files and settings remove
and/or change (how) in the spec files?
